
A Manitowoc healthcare group is being recognized by the Wisconsin Department of Health Services for making sure children get their immediate vaccines once they’re born.
The Wisconsin BigShot awards were given out to 90 healthcare providers across the state who’ve had 90% or more of their patients vaccinated for babies who are 24-36 months old.
Prevea Manitowoc Health Center falls in the Routine Childhood Vaccine category, while other healthcare clinics fall into the one MMR dose by 24 months category.
They include Bellin Health Luxemburg, Aurora Health Care of Kaukauna, and Ascension Little Chute.
The Department of Health Services says there are more, but not all healthcare groups decided to have their names published.
